Output 303d520890c0b4bc28748c7f71be41b12773b43d70413ba31fd17bb5031ff87b:18

value
122371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82b8cc7ce7cab9e39b37ec75e8e59e30e41d94e1 OP_EQUAL
address
3DcD9XU5QV2w64b28cYoPuZjhbjyJe6Rd7
transaction
303d520890c0b4bc28748c7f71be41b12773b43d70413ba31fd17bb5031ff87b
spent
true